Fact Sheet: USCIS Offers Premium Processing For Certain Form I-140 Petitions

On June 11, 2008, USCIS posted this Fact Sheet regarding the decision to make Premium Processing Service available for designated Form I-140 petitions (Immigrant Petition for Alien Worker) filed for alien workers in H-1B nonimmigrant status who are reaching the end of their sixth year in H-1B nonimmigrant status. Starting on June 16, 2008, USCIS will begin accepting Form I-907, Request for Premium Processing Service, for Forms I-140 filed for alien beneficiaries who, as of the date of filing the Form I-907:
  • Are currently in H-1B nonimmigrant status;
  • Will reach the sixth year of their H-1B nonimmigrant stay in 60 days;
  • Are only eligible for a further H-1B extension under AC21 §104(c)2 upon approval of their Form I-140 petition; and
  • Are ineligible to extend their H-1B status under AC21 §106(a)3.
